Hi all....I recall reading on the boards during the last few months that some sellers were having problems with SOLD items being RE-LISTED, by eBay....whether a technical glitch, or something to do with the multiple-item clock not working.
Does anyone else have this problem? Does anyone have the link to the thread?
It has happened to me several times now, and I am still going through my listings....unable to work it out

@wilmajames123 wrote:This first happened to me about six months ago. Everything I sell is "one-of-a-kind" and when I was unable to find an item that had sold I panicked. It was some hours before I realized that the item had been bought a few weeks earlier by the very same US buyer. I called eBay, and after a long time on the phone and being passed from one person to another, I was patched through to ebay.com as well. The verdict: it was a very unusual glitch. The next time it happened I was prepared. Strangely, that was also to a US buyer. Now I check every item against listings as a precaution. This is possible as I'm just a small seller.
YOURE RIGHT !!! ......... ( lightbulb suddenly goes on ) .....I Hadnt noticed it before you pointed it out, but both of my mystery relists where purchased by U.S buyers too.

It has happened at least twice to me - I sell one-offs and do not sell OS - so that is not the problem. One was from an item sold last August, which somehow was relisted and resold again this year and it was so embarrasing when I coudn't find it. But going back through my sales records, discovered why - it had already been sold. And then it happened again recently with an item originally sold last November but somehow got relisted and then resold.

It has happened to me a handfull of times including quite recently. My usual modus operandi is to explain to the buyer that it is an ebay glitch and refund their money, without cancelling the transaction. It is annoying as I lose the ebay commission, but better than coping a defect for out of stock. It is not worth the agravation of phoning CS and spending hours trying to get them to sort it. .......Lifes too short for that sort of stuff. I just write it off as another bad ebay joke and get on with it.
